Abstract:
A method of controlling a flowrate of molten material (121) at a downstream location (203) in a glass manufacturing process (100) comprises forming a glass ribbon (103) from the molten material (121) at the flowrate; calculating the flowrate of the molten material (121) from which the glass ribbon (103) was formed; calculating a viscosity of the molten material (121) at an upstream location (201) positioned upstream from the downstream location (203) relative to a flow direction of the molten material (121); estimating the flowrate based on the calculated viscosity and the calculated flowrate; and controlling the flowrate of the molten material (121) at the downstream location (203) based on the estimated flowrate.
